文章目录集合所属的类在java.util包下集合可分为两种collection单列存储,map双列集合一、collection(单列集合)list:存储有序的、数据可重复ArrayList、LinkedList、Vector三种实现类ArraryList:LIst的主要实现类,线程不安全、效率高底层使用Object[ ]存储,在JDK7中初始创建时长度为10,在JDK8开始创建时先初始化为DEF
转载
2024-07-20 10:01:31
24阅读
Mysql存储过程与事务总结mysql中的变量系统变量select @@变量名自定义变量select @变量名存储过程存储过程的概念所谓存储过程就是封装一个完整业务的操作,其中包括:变量、逻辑控制以及操作数据的SQL语句(类似于Java中的方法)存储过程的语法-- 10.发送添加群的消息
-- 1)插入数据到消息信息表MessageInfo中
-- 2)插入数据到群消息信息表GroupMess
转载
2023-12-21 11:30:18
59阅读
package ArrayListDemo;
import java.util.ArrayList;
import java.util.Scanner;
/*案例:存储学生对象并遍历
需求:创建一个存储学生对象的集合,并使用键盘录入的方法录入数据,然后将数据存储到集合中遍历并输出
分析:1.创建学生类,成员变量类型为String 因为是获取键盘录入的数据
2.
转载
2023-05-26 16:09:23
151阅读
怎么利用MyBatis传List类型参数到数据库存储过程中实现批量插入数据?MyBatis中参数是List类型时怎么处理?大家都知道MyBatis批处理大量数据是很难做到事务回滚的(事务由Spring管理),都将逻辑写在存储中又是及其头疼的一件事(参数长度也有限制),那么我想的是将参数在后台封装为单个或多个list集合,直接通过MyBatis将此参数传到数据库存储过程中,一来摆脱了MyBatis批
转载
2023-07-25 11:51:18
118阅读
# Java调用存储过程返回List
## 引言
在Java开发中,经常需要与数据库进行交互。存储过程是一种在数据库中预先编译的可重用SQL代码块。它可以接受参数,并且可以返回一个或多个结果。本文将介绍如何使用Java调用存储过程,并将返回结果封装为一个List。
## 准备工作
在开始之前,我们需要先准备好以下的环境和工具:
- JDK(Java Development Kit):用于编写和
原创
2024-01-11 09:45:19
114阅读
看到RETURN的返回值不同,代表意义各不同,能过查找,得出以下结论:RETURN语句会导致过程立即退出。考察下面的例子:CREATE PROCEDURE check_tables
(@who VARCHAR(30))
AS
IF EXISTS(SELECT name FROM Philosophers WHERE name=@who)
BEGIN
PRINT “In the Philosophe
转载
2024-09-20 19:31:31
12阅读
1. 当需要把插入多条数据的行为合并为一个事务时,可以考虑把一个list型数据作为参数传入存储过程,
2. 可以调用jdbc内部实现类来实现,这些类在classes12.zip(oracle 8,别的版本可能是其他名字的zip包)。
3. 如:
4. 需要将一个list传入存储过程。
5. 具体操作如下:
6. 1,建立数据库对象来映射lis
转载
2023-06-29 22:01:24
140阅读
# Java接收存储过程返回List
在Java的开发过程中,我们经常会遇到需要调用数据库存储过程,并将其返回结果封装成List的情况。本文将介绍如何在Java中接收存储过程返回的结果并将其封装成List。
## 存储过程
存储过程是一组预先编译好的SQL语句集,可以接收参数并返回结果。在数据库中,存储过程可以提高性能,并且可以通过存储过程实现事务控制、数据校验等功能。
## Java调用
原创
2024-04-14 04:29:16
63阅读
在使用oracle进行批量插入的时,如果数据量较小可以使用insert all的语法进行批量插入。如果数据量较大,再使用insert all的语句插入就会发生错误,因为这个语法会受到限制,oracle不允许一次性插入的列数乘以行数>1000,这时就可以考虑使用存储过程批量插入了。 使用存储过程批量插入很显然要接收一个数组当参数,而且这个数组里的元素类型应该和java里自定义的数据模型对应。
转载
2024-01-08 14:15:08
108阅读
# MySQL存储过程中的列表变量
MySQL是一种流行的关系型数据库管理系统,它提供了许多功能强大的特性来处理数据。其中之一就是存储过程,它可以让我们在数据库中编写可重用的代码块来执行一系列的操作。在MySQL存储过程中,我们可以使用列表变量来存储和操作多个值。本文将介绍如何在MySQL存储过程中使用列表变量,并提供一些示例代码。
## 列表变量的定义和使用
在MySQL存储过程中,我们可
原创
2023-10-29 04:31:36
372阅读
# 学习MySQL存储过程的定义与实现
欢迎进入MySQL存储过程的世界。对于新手开发者来说,掌握存储过程的创建与使用是非常关键的步骤。本文将为你详细介绍如何定义一个存储过程,并为你提供必要的代码示例和注释。接下来,我们将通过一个简单的流程帮助你掌握这项技能。
## 流程概述
下面是实现MySQL存储过程的一般流程:
| 步骤 | 内容描述
# MySQL 存储过程返回列表的实现
对于初入职场的开发者来说,学习如何在 MySQL 数据库中编写存储过程是一项非常重要的技能。存储过程不仅能够帮助我们将一些操作封装在一起,提高代码的重用性,还能优化数据库的性能。本文将教你如何实现一个 MySQL 存储过程,该过程会返回一个列表(List)。
## 实现流程
为了更好地理解如何实现这个过程,我们将整个流程分为以下几个步骤:
| 步骤
# MySQL存储过程list参数实现指南
作为一名经验丰富的开发者,我很高兴能帮助你了解如何在MySQL中实现存储过程的list参数。在这篇文章中,我将向你展示整个流程,并提供详细的代码示例和注释,以确保你能够顺利实现。
## 流程图
首先,让我们通过一个流程图来了解实现MySQL存储过程list参数的步骤:
```mermaid
flowchart TD
A[开始] --> B
原创
2024-07-28 07:59:23
63阅读
# 使用MySQL存储过程传递List参数
在MySQL中,存储过程是一组预定义的SQL语句,可以在数据库中重复使用。存储过程可以接受参数,并返回结果。当我们需要传递多个值作为参数时,我们可以使用List来传递数据。在本文中,我们将介绍如何在MySQL存储过程中传递List参数,并提供相应的代码示例。
## 为什么需要传递List参数?
通常情况下,存储过程接受的参数是单个值。但是,在某些情
原创
2024-01-20 06:25:44
332阅读
## MySQL存储过程参数列表的实现
### 介绍
MySQL存储过程是一种在数据库服务器上预先编译并存储的一组SQL语句,可以通过简单调用来执行。存储过程可以接受参数,这样可以在调用时传递不同的值。本文将教你如何在MySQL中实现存储过程参数列表。
### 实现流程
首先,我们来看一下整个实现的流程,可以用以下表格展示:
| 步骤 | 描述 |
| ---- | ---- |
| 步骤1
原创
2023-10-22 06:57:35
43阅读
# 如何实现 MySQL 存储过程接收 List: 一个初学者的指南
在软件开发过程中,我们常常需要从应用程序向数据库发送多个数据项。MySQL 的存储过程是一种有效的方式,可以处理这类情况。然而,MySQL 本身并不直接支持接收数组或列表(List)。但是,我们可以通过一些步骤将列表转换为可以被存储过程接收的格式。本文将会详细介绍这一过程,帮助初学者快速上手。
## 整体流程
以下是实现
原创
2024-08-23 09:18:04
72阅读
## MySQL 存储过程传入 List 的实现
在这篇文章中,我们将学习如何在 MySQL 中创建一个存储过程,该存储过程可以接收一个列表(List)的输入。这个过程分为几个步骤,我们将通过表格来清晰地展示每一步的流程。
### 流程步骤
| 步骤 | 描述 | 代码示例 |
|------|-------------------
原创
2024-10-03 04:58:12
107阅读
MySQL存储过程的介绍MySQL 5.0版本开始支持存储过程 SQL语句需要先编译然后执行存储过程(Stored Procedure)是一组为了完成特定功能的SQL语句集经编译后存储在数据库中,通过指定存储过程的名字并给定参数来调用执行它数据库中的存储过程可以看做是编程语言中方法函数优点:1. 大大提高数据库的处理速度2. 提高数据库编程的灵活性语法CREATE PROCEDURE 过程名([
转载
2024-09-30 11:46:43
26阅读
# 实现mysql存储过程接收list
## 引言
作为一名经验丰富的开发者,我将向你介绍如何在mysql中实现存储过程接收list参数的方法。这对于刚入行的小白来说可能会比较困惑,但是通过本文的指导,你将能够轻松掌握这一技巧。
## 整体流程
下面是实现“mysql存储过程接收list”所需的步骤:
| 步骤 | 描述 |
| --- | --- |
| 1 | 创建一个存储过程 |
|
原创
2024-03-07 06:39:32
313阅读
## MySQL 存储过程返回 List
在使用 MySQL 数据库进行应用程序开发时,经常会遇到需要返回多个结果集的情况。这时,可以使用存储过程来实现该功能。存储过程是一组预定义的 SQL 语句,可以被多次调用并且可以接受参数。
本文将介绍如何在 MySQL 中编写存储过程,并返回一个列表(List)作为结果。我们将围绕一个示例展开,通过这个示例来说明如何编写存储过程并返回一个 List。
原创
2024-01-26 04:33:26
122阅读